在Java Web开发中,我们经常会遇到各种类型的null值。这些null值可能会引发异常,影响程序的稳定性。因此,如何妥善处理null值成为了我们必须要面对的问题。本文将以JSP为例,为大家详细介绍如何将null值变成0,让你轻松应对null值处理问题。
一、为什么要将null变成0?
在Java中,null代表一个对象没有任何引用,也就是说,它不指向任何内存地址。而0是一个具体的值,代表整数类型中的零。将null变成0有以下几点好处:
1. 避免程序异常:当程序中出现null值时,如果我们将其变成0,就可以避免因null值而导致的NullPointerException。
2. 提高代码可读性:将null变成0可以让代码更加直观,易于理解。
3. 统一数据类型:在某些场景下,我们需要统一数据类型,将null变成0可以帮助我们实现这一目标。
二、JSP中将null变成0的实例
下面,我们将通过具体的实例来讲解如何在JSP中将null变成0。
1. 使用EL表达式
EL(Expression Language)表达式是JSP中的一个强大工具,它允许我们直接在JSP页面中访问对象属性和执行运算。
示例:
```jsp
<%@ page contentType="